> During stress testing it is fairly easy to reproduce a segfault in
> resched_pop_front. Using gdb it is easy to see that polled_resched_front can
> be zero when entering this function which causes the value to wrap and then a
> crash in later calls.
> polled_resched_front is not checked when calling this function in one
> instance, the trivial fix to check this value is seen in the attached patch
> seems to work.
> Tested with Qpid Proton C++ 0.37.
